Notă biografică
Aris Daniilidis is Professor of Applied Mathematics at TU Wien, working in the fields of Variational Analysis, Optimization and Dynamical Systems. Before joining TU Wien, he held faculty positions at the Universitat Autònoma de Barcelona and the University of Chile. He is currently Head of the Research Unit VADOR (Variational Analysis, Dynamics and Operations Research) at TU Wien. He has held numerous visiting positions, mainly in France and Italy, including at École Polytechnique, Paris-Saclay, INSA Rennes, and the universities of Milan and Naples. He has authored approximately 80 research publications in leading international journals in mathematics and optimization. He serves on the editorial boards of several journals in optimization and mathematical analysis.
Akhtar A. Khan is a Professor of Applied Mathematics at the Rochester Institute of Technology, Rochester, NY, USA. His research interests encompass inverse problems, uncertainty quantification, optimization, and variational inequalities. He has authored over 120 research articles. Dr. Khan has been a visiting professor at several European universities and serves on the editorial boards of five leading journals. He is also a co-Chief Editor of the Journal of Applied and Numerical Optimization. In addition to his publication record, Dr. Khan has co-authored two monographs, co-edited three books, and co-edited 12 special issues of renowned journals.
Christiane Tammer is a professor at Martin-Luther-University Halle-Wittenberg, Germany, working in the fields of variational methods and optimization. Before taking up this position, she was a Visiting Professor at the Royal Military College of Canada and at the Universities of Leipzig and Kaiserslautern. She has co-authored 6 monographs. MathSciNet lists over 170 papers. She is Editor in Chief of the journal Optimization, Co-Editor in Chief of the Journal Applied Set-Valued Analysis and Optimization and the journal Optimization Eruditorum. Furthermore, she is a member of the Editorial Board of several journals, the Scientific Committee of the Working Group on Generalized Convexity and the Academic Committee of the International Research Center for Mathematical Optimization, Yunnan Normal University, Kunming, China.

Descriere
Optimization under Uncertainty presents a comprehensive overview of recent theoretical and computational advances in optimization under uncertainty. It places particular emphasis on scalar, vector, and set-valued optimization problems affected by uncertain data.
